    Position Summary:
    We are seeking a talented QE/Test Automation Engineer with a focus on mobile applications to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in test automation frameworks and tools, particularly within the mobile space. They will be responsible for designing, developing, and executing automated tests to ensure the quality and reliability of our mobile applications.
    Key Responsibilities:
    • Design and develop automated test scripts and frameworks for mobile applications across various platforms (iOS and Android).
    • Collaborate with the QA team to analyze project requirements and identify test automation opportunities.
    • Implement and maintain continuous integration and delivery pipelines to automate the execution of test suites.
    • Conduct code reviews and provide feedback to ensure the quality and maintainability of test automation code.
    • Execute automated test suites to identify defects, bugs, and performance issues in mobile applications.
    • Integrate automated tests into the overall software development lifecycle, including build verification, regression testing, and release validation.
